How Trade Influenced Food
At its greatest extent under Emperor Trajan in the early 2nd century AD, the Roman Empire stretched all the way from Scotland to Southern Egypt, but also stretched to Mesopotamia in the east and Morocco in the West. This enormity encompassed a variety of different cultures and traditions, each offering a unique addition to the empire itself. Alexandrine Fish Sauce
Recipe [225] [437] ALEXANDRINE [1] SAUCE FOR BROILED FISH IUS ALEXANDRINUM IN PISCE ASSO PEPPER, DRY ONIONS [shallots] LOVAGE, CUMIN, ORIGANY, CELERY SEED, STONED DAMASCUS PRUNES [pounded in the mortar] FILLED UP [2] WITH VINEGAR, BROTH, REDUCED MUST, AND OIL, AND COOK IT. [1] Alexandria, Egyptian city, at the mouth of the river Nile, third of the three great cities of antiquity excepting Carthage during Apicius’ time a rival of Rome and Athens in splendor and commerce.
